The Fundamentals of Artificial Intelligence

Artificial intelligence is a field focused on creating machines capable of performing tasks typically requiring human intelligence, such as learning, problem-solving, and decision-making. At its core, AI employs machine learning (ML) to enable systems to improve their performance on specific tasks without explicit programming for each one.

Key concepts underpinning the world of AI include:

  • Machine Learning: A subset of AI where algorithms can adapt and learn from data without being explicitly programmed.
  • Deep Learning: A type of ML that involves neural networks with multiple layers to analyze complex patterns in data.
  • Neural Networks: Inspired by the structure of human brains, these are networks of interconnected nodes (neurons) that process information.

These concepts form the foundation for understanding how AI is applied in various consumer tech contexts. For instance, virtual assistants like Alexa and Google Assistant use natural language processing (NLP), a form of ML, to interpret voice commands and perform tasks accordingly.

Smart Home Devices: An Introduction to AI-Powered Technology

Smart home devices represent one of the most visible applications of AI in consumer technology. These devices integrate various components, including sensors, cameras, and voice assistants, all working together to provide an intelligent experience for users. Here are a few ways AI is leveraged in smart home technology:

  • Voice Assistants: Integration with virtual assistants allows for voice control over lighting, temperature, security systems, and more.
  • Security Systems: AI-powered monitoring can detect anomalies in behavior or physical changes that may indicate intruders.
  • Energy Management: Smart thermostats and lighting systems use predictive algorithms to optimize energy usage based on occupancy patterns.

These devices enhance convenience while contributing to the broader ecosystem of AI-driven smart homes. By leveraging data from various sources, these systems offer a tailored experience for each user, adjusting settings and notifications according to their preferences and behavior.

Virtual Assistants: Understanding Their Role in Consumer Tech

Virtual assistants are among the most visible manifestations of AI in consumer technology. These assistants use NLP to understand voice commands and perform tasks on behalf of the user. Here’s a closer look at how popular virtual assistants work:

  • Natural Language Processing: The ability of these assistants to interpret spoken language into actionable commands or queries.
  • Machine Learning: Behind every effective virtual assistant is an ML algorithm that improves its performance based on usage patterns.

Alexa, Google Assistant, and Siri are among the most well-known virtual assistants. While each has unique capabilities, they all rely on AI for understanding user intent and executing tasks efficiently.

Personalization: The Impact of AI on Your Consumer Experience

AI-driven personalization is a key aspect of consumer tech products. These algorithms use data about your behavior and preferences to tailor recommendations, content, or services just for you:

  • Product Recommendations: Online retailers and streaming platforms use collaborative filtering, a type of ML, to suggest products based on what others like you have bought or watched.
  • Content Curation: AI-driven feeds recommend content based on your viewing history and engagement patterns.

However, personalization raises concerns about data privacy and the potential for bias in algorithms. Understanding how these systems work is essential for making informed choices about the types of data shared and with whom.

The Dark Side of AI: Potential Risks and Concerns

While AI has numerous benefits in consumer tech, there are also risks and concerns that must be addressed:

  • Data Privacy: As more devices and services collect personal data, there’s a growing concern about how this information is stored, shared, and protected.
  • Bias: Algorithms can perpetuate biases present in the data used to train them, leading to unfair outcomes or discriminatory recommendations.
  • Job Displacement: AI may displace certain jobs, particularly those involving repetitive tasks or decision-making that can be automated.

These risks underscore the need for transparency and accountability in AI development and deployment. By being aware of these potential pitfalls, consumers can advocate for safer and more equitable use of AI in consumer tech products.

The Transformative Power of AI: Enhancing Productivity and Creativity

Beyond its applications in smart home devices and virtual assistants, AI has a transformative impact on various creative and productive tasks:

  • Writing Tools: AI-powered writing assistance tools suggest grammar corrections, rephrase sentences for clarity, and even generate entire drafts based on prompts.
  • Design Software: Graphic design and video editing apps now include AI-driven features that predict user intent or automate complex processes like color palette suggestions.
  • Music Production: AI algorithms can compose original music based on a theme, genre, or even a specific mood.

While these tools are still evolving, they represent a significant leap forward in augmenting human creativity and productivity.
